How old is DC? We started with purees initially a baby spoonful or two, at this stage milk shout be main source of nutrition until a year but as thry get older you can introduce more x

Horehound · 03/05/2020 22:04

I also started with purée and have slowly introduced finger foods like a stick of avocado, cheese, a slice of omelette etc.
You just do very tiny amounts to begin with (like a couple of teaspoons) then increase as per your babies appetite
